How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Claycomo?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Claycomo Studio Apartments | $925 | $765 | $1,250 |
| Claycomo 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,196 | $845 | $1,878 |
| Claycomo 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,482 | $895 | $2,277 |
| Claycomo 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,813 | $1,280 | $2,825 |
| Claycomo 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,492 | $1,430 | $3,059 |
